2018-05-09 16:53 GMT+09:00 Masahiro Yamada <yamada.masahiro@xxxxxxxxxxxxx>: > VMLINUX_SYMBOL() is no-op unless CONFIG_HAVE_UNDERSCORE_SYMBOL_PREFIX > is defined. It has ever been selected only by BLACKFIN and METAG. > VMLINUX_SYMBOL() is unneeded for SuperH-specific code. > > Signed-off-by: Masahiro Yamada <yamada.masahiro@xxxxxxxxxxxxx> > --- For information for SH maintainers just in case. I already picked up this patch to my Kbuild tree. Thanks. > arch/sh/include/asm/vmlinux.lds.h | 4 ++-- > 1 file changed, 2 insertions(+), 2 deletions(-) > > diff --git a/arch/sh/include/asm/vmlinux.lds.h b/arch/sh/include/asm/vmlinux.lds.h > index f312813..9929556 100644 > --- a/arch/sh/include/asm/vmlinux.lds.h > +++ b/arch/sh/include/asm/vmlinux.lds.h > @@ -7,9 +7,9 @@ > #ifdef CONFIG_DWARF_UNWINDER > #define DWARF_EH_FRAME \ > .eh_frame : AT(ADDR(.eh_frame) - LOAD_OFFSET) { \ > - VMLINUX_SYMBOL(__start_eh_frame) = .; \ > + __start_eh_frame = .; \ > *(.eh_frame) \ > - VMLINUX_SYMBOL(__stop_eh_frame) = .; \ > + __stop_eh_frame = .; \ > } > #else > #define DWARF_EH_FRAME > -- > 2.7.4 > -- Best Regards Masahiro Yamada